Description
Attendant at Douglas Parking lot on east side of Franklin south of 14th intentionally placed a stand up sign blocking the bike lane. Two cyclists stopped to move the sign out of the bike lane after which the attendant placed it back in the lane. When I stopped and asked the attendant to keep the bike lane clear he refused, stating that his supervisor Mohammed required him to place it there. The Franklin Street bike lane is already blocked enough by double parkers, construction, glass, and delivery vehicles. Please ensure that parking lot attendants don't add to this with poorly placed signage.
